Transaction 109d11511cdb6f8b483042c87997c5b93aabe7e247b6562d923598674273cffd

3 Input
2 Outputs
  • 109d11511cdb6f8b483042c87997c5b93aabe7e247b6562d923598674273cffd:0
  • value  57457500
    address  1E4RY5D6DpHVLDQ1XhWAcwqeLL9y5xoz65
  • 109d11511cdb6f8b483042c87997c5b93aabe7e247b6562d923598674273cffd:1
  • value  14258355
    address  3HgkEfDdArLxsoWx7MZ59XKXHHRs94Qnzh